  1. DStv Overview: DStv is a Sub-Saharan African direct broadcast satellite service owned by MultiChoice.

  2. Service Launch: DStv was launched in 1995, providing various bouquets offering general entertainment, movies, lifestyle & culture, sport, documentaries, news & commerce, children, music, religion, and consumer channels.

  3. Installation Services: DStv installation typically involves setting up a satellite dish, decoder, and connecting these to the television.

  4. Coverage: DStv services are available in over 50 countries across Africa, including South Africa, Nigeria, Kenya, Ghana, Angola, Zimbabwe, Uganda, and more.

  5. Decoders: Different types of decoders are available, like the DStv Explora, which offers features like recording, pause, and rewind.

  6. High Definition: Many DStv channels are available in HD, requiring an HD capable decoder.

  7. Subscription Packages: Various subscription packages are available, catering to different preferences and budgets.

  8. Self Service: DStv offers self-service options for subscription management, including mobile apps and online platforms.

  9. Accredited Installers: DStv recommends using accredited installers for proper dish alignment and signal optimization.

  10. Signal Challenges: Installation in certain areas may face challenges due to signal obstructions or extreme weather conditions.

  11. Installation Costs: Costs can vary depending on the complexity of the installation, type of equipment, and region.

  12. After-sales Support: DStv provides customer support for troubleshooting and service-related issues.

  13. Smart LNBs: Modern installations might use Smart LNBs, which are designed for Explora decoders.

  14. Mobile Streaming: DStv Now allows for streaming live TV and accessing content on the go.

  15. Updates and Upgrades: Regular decoder software updates are provided to enhance functionality.

  16. Parental Control: Decoders come with parental control features to manage content accessibility for children.

  17. Accessibility Features: Some decoders include features for visually or hearing-impaired viewers.

  18. Power Requirements: Installations require a stable power source, which can be a challenge in areas with frequent power outages.

  19. Satellite Dish Sizes: Different regions might require different dish sizes for optimal reception.

  20. Multilingual Support: DStv offers channels in various languages, reflecting the diverse audience in Africa.

About Centurion, GP

Centurion (previously known as Verwoerdburg and before that Lyttelton) is an area with 236,580 inhabitants (2011 census) in the Gauteng Province of South Africa, between Pretoria and Midrand. Formerly an independent municipality, with its own town council, it has been part of the City of Tshwane Metropolitan Municipality since 2000. Its heart is at the intersection of the N1 and N14 freeways. The R21 freeway also passes through the eastern part of Centurion. The Waterkloof Air Force Base, as well as the Swartkop Air Force Base (which includes the South African Air Force Museum), are in Centurion. == History == === Prehistoric === Fossils discovered at the Sterkfontein Caves show that hominids lived in the vicinity of Centurion between 2 and 3 million years ago. The Sterkfontein Caves, a World Heritage Site, is less than 50 km from Centurion, near Mogale City and Krugersdorp. However, the earliest evidence of modern human habitation in the Centurion area does not go this far back. It dates back to 1200 AD when black African communities settled in this area. They cultivated lands, grazed their cattle, made earthenware containers and melted iron.

The installation time can vary depending on a few factors, such as the complexity of the installation, the number of decoders being installed, and the location of the installation. In general, a standard installation with one decoder can take around 1-2 hours, while a more complex installation with multiple decoders and additional features may take longer.

There are a few steps you can take to try and fix a weak or non-existent DSTV signal. First, make sure all cables and connections are securely in place. Check that there are no obstructions blocking the signal, such as trees or buildings. You can also try resetting your decoder by unplugging it from the power source for a few minutes, then plugging it back in. If none of these steps work, it may be necessary to call in a professional DSTV repair technician.

The cost of repairing a DSTV system can vary depending on the type and extent of the damage. A simple repair may only cost a few hundred rand, while a more complex repair could run into the thousands. It’s important to get a quote from a reputable repair technician before proceeding with any repairs, and to make sure that the cost of the repair is proportional to the value of the system. In some cases, it may be more cost-effective to replace the system entirely.

While it is technically possible to install DSTV yourself, it is generally recommended to hire a professional installer. This is because installing DSTV can be a complex and potentially dangerous process, particularly if you need to install the dish on a high roof or other difficult-to-reach location. A professional installer will have the knowledge, experience, and equipment necessary to ensure that your DSTV system is installed safely and correctly.

There are several issues that can cause DSTV signal problems, including damaged cables or connectors, misaligned satellite dishes, and obstructions blocking the signal. In some cases, the issue may be related to the DSTV decoder itself, such as outdated software or a faulty hardware component. A professional DSTV repair technician will be able to diagnose the issue and recommend the best course of action to fix it.
